Clinical Practice:

  • Intensive care, particularly related to acute lung injury/acute respiratory distress syndrome (ARDS)
  • High frequency oscillation (HFO) ventilation
  • Physical rehabilitation and mobilization in the intensive care unit (ICU)

Research Interests:

  • Changing medical care in the ICU to improve patients’ quality of life, and physical and mental health during their recovery from critical illness after hospital discharge

  • Improving methods of physical rehabilitation in the ICU setting to reduce muscle weakness and functional impairment

  • Patient safety, quality of care and knowledge translation of evidence-based therapy in the ICU
